According to cops, there were more than 200 people inside the Airbnb at the time, including several minors, when multiple attackers opened fire, killing two teenage boys and injuring eight others. They are currently in critical condition. According to investigators, up to 50 rounds were fired inside the flat, leading several participants to jump out the windows. According to WTAE, at least two of those partygoers suffered fractured bones and injuries as a result of the jump.

However, investigators indicated during a press conference on Sunday afternoon that they now believe there were a total of 90 rounds fired in what Police Chief Scott Schubert described as a “very chaotic situation.” Officers from Pittsburgh Zone 1 told WTAE that they were called to the scene early on Easter Sunday after receiving many ShotSpotter alarms. By the time police arrived at the scene in the 800 block of Suismon Street in the city’s Deutschtown area, more rounds had been fired.

According to Pittsburgh police, an investigation into the incident is ongoing, with evidence being gathered from as many as eight separate crime sites covering a few blocks around where the shooting occurred. WTAE reporter Ashley Zilka’s photos show automobiles with damaged windows and a seemingly misplaced sneaker outside the flat. A smashed 2nd party window hug open across the street, according to a media news outlet, and a Subaru Legacy was covered with blood less than a block away.

At the scene, shell shells from pistols and rifles were also uncovered. According to authorities, numerous gunshot victims were brought to nearby hospitals by EMS teams, while others found private transportation. Two of the patients died as a result of their injuries while at the hospital, although Commander John Fisher reported that the majority of the patients are in stable condition. Schubert reported that one of those who died was only 14 years old. It is unclear who rented the Airbnb, but Allegheny County real estate records show that the home is owned by 900 North Group LLC, according to a media outlet.
